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H 2/2] Add support for generating a systemtap tapset static probes
Date: Mon, 8 Nov 2010 11:33:04 +0000

From: Daniel P. Berrange <address@hidden>

This introduces generation of a qemu.stp/qemu-system-XXX.stp
files which provides tapsets with friendly names for static
probes & their arguments. Instead of

    probe process("qemu").mark("qemu_malloc") {
        printf("Malloc %d %p\n", $arg1, $arg2);
    }

It is now possible todo

    probe qemu.system.i386.qemu_malloc {
        printf("Malloc %d %p\n", size, ptr);
    }

There is one tapset defined per target arch.

* Makefile: Generate a qemu.stp file for systemtap
* tracetool: Support for generating systemtap tapsets

 Makefile.target |   19 +++++++++++-
 configure       |    7 ++++
 tracetool       |   92 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 3 files changed, 117 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)

diff --git a/Makefile.target b/Makefile.target
index 91e6e74..a5e6410 100644
--- a/Makefile.target
+++ b/Makefile.target
@@ -40,7 +40,20 @@ kvm.o kvm-all.o vhost.o vhost_net.o: 
QEMU_CFLAGS+=$(KVM_CFLAGS)
 config-target.h: config-target.h-timestamp
 config-target.h-timestamp: config-target.mak
 
-all: $(PROGS)
+ifdef CONFIG_SYSTEMTAP_TRACE
+trace: $(QEMU_PROG).stp
+
+$(QEMU_PROG).stp:
+       $(call quiet-command,sh $(SRC_PATH)/tracetool \
+               --$(TRACE_BACKEND) \
+               --bindir $(bindir) \
+               --target $(TARGET_ARCH) \
+               -s < $(SRC_PATH)/trace-events > $(QEMU_PROG).stp,"  GEN   
$(QEMU_PROG).stp")
+else
+trace:
+endif
+
+all: $(PROGS) trace
 
 # Dummy command so that make thinks it has done something
        @true
@@ -348,6 +361,10 @@ ifneq ($(STRIP),)
        $(STRIP) $(patsubst %,"$(DESTDIR)$(bindir)/%",$(PROGS))
 endif
 endif
+ifdef CONFIG_SYSTEMTAP_TRACE
+       $(INSTALL_DIR) "$(DESTDIR)$(datadir)/../systemtap/tapset"
+       $(INSTALL_DATA) $(QEMU_PROG).stp 
"$(DESTDIR)$(datadir)/../systemtap/tapset"
+endif
 
 # Include automatically generated dependency files
 -include $(wildcard *.d */*.d)
diff --git a/configure b/configure
index f8dad3e..e560f87 100755
--- a/configure
+++ b/configure
@@ -2192,6 +2192,10 @@ EOF
     echo
     exit 1
   fi
+  trace_backend_stap="no"
+  if has 'stap' ; then
+    trace_backend_stap="yes"
+  fi
 fi
 
 ##########################################
@@ -2645,6 +2649,9 @@ fi
 if test "$trace_backend" = "simple"; then
   trace_file="\"$trace_file-%u\""
 fi
+if test "$trace_backend" = "dtrace" -a "$trace_backend_stap" = "yes" ; then
+  echo "CONFIG_SYSTEMTAP_TRACE=y" >> $config_host_mak
+fi
 echo "CONFIG_TRACE_FILE=$trace_file" >> $config_host_mak
 
 echo "TOOLS=$tools" >> $config_host_mak
diff --git a/tracetool b/tracetool
index 5b6636a..d797ab7 100755
--- a/tracetool
+++ b/tracetool
@@ -26,6 +26,12 @@ Output formats:
   -h    Generate .h file
   -c    Generate .c file
   -d    Generate .d file (DTrace only)
+  -s    Generate .stp file (DTrace with SystemTAP only)
+
+Options:
+  --bindir [bindir]  QEMU binary install location
+  --target [arch]    QEMU target architecture
+
 EOF
     exit 1
 }
@@ -390,6 +396,54 @@ linetod_end_dtrace()
 EOF
 }
 
+linetos_begin_dtrace()
+{
+    return
+}
+
+linetos_dtrace()
+{
+    local name args arglist state
+    name=$(get_name "$1")
+    args=$(get_args "$1")
+    arglist=$(get_argnames "$1", "")
+    state=$(get_state "$1")
+    if [ "$state" = "0" ] ; then
+        name=${name##disable }
+    fi
+
+    if [ "$target" = "i386" ]
+    then
+      binary="qemu"
+    else
+      binary="qemu-system-$target"
+    fi
+
+    # Define prototype for probe arguments
+    cat <<EOF
+probe qemu.system.$target.$name = process("$bindir/$binary").mark("$name")
+{
+EOF
+
+    i=1
+    for arg in $arglist
+    do
+        cat <<EOF
+  $arg = \$arg$i;
+EOF
+       i="$((i+1))"
+    done
+
+    cat <<EOF
+}
+EOF
+}
+
+linetos_end_dtrace()
+{
+    return
+}
+
 # Process stdin by calling begin, line, and end functions for the backend
 convert()
 {
@@ -455,6 +509,24 @@ tracetod()
     convert d
 }
 
+tracetos()
+{
+    if [ $backend != "dtrace" ]; then
+       echo "SystemTAP tapset generator not applicable to $backend backend"
+       exit 1
+    fi
+    if [ -z "$target" ]; then
+       echo "--target is required for SystemTAP tapset generator"
+       exit 1
+    fi
+    if [ -z "$bindir" ]; then
+       echo "--bindir is required for SystemTAP tapset generator"
+       exit 1
+    fi
+    echo "/* This file is autogenerated by tracetool, do not edit. */"
+    convert s
+}
+
 # Choose backend
 case "$1" in
 "--nop" | "--simple" | "--ust" | "--dtrace") backend="${1#--}" ;;
@@ -462,10 +534,30 @@ case "$1" in
 esac
 shift
 
+bindir=
+case "$1" in
+  "--bindir")
+    bindir=$2
+    shift
+    shift
+    ;;
+esac
+
+target=
+case "$1" in
+  "--target")
+    target=$2
+    shift
+    shift
+    ;;
+esac
+
+
 case "$1" in
 "-h") tracetoh ;;
 "-c") tracetoc ;;
 "-d") tracetod ;;
+"-s") tracetos ;;
 "--check-backend") exit 0 ;; # used by ./configure to test for backend
 *) usage ;;
 esac
